True Pleasure's run of consistent form came to an end unfortunately. No excuse with conditions and it wasn't a run where you could make a judgment on her handicap mark. Maybe it was a case of going to the well one too many times. Still, her form in ideal conditions this season now reads 1,1,3,2,5. For the time being she is one to be wary of.

Strictly there are No Qualifiers tomorrow. However there is one who's profile is built around his ground preference. Given how unreliable both official going conditions can be as well as the weather, I will always highlight these runners for information...

3.45 York Prince of Johanne 

Ideal Cond: Good to Firm, OR100 or below 

Form in Cond: 1,1,5,7,2,6,3,6,1,1,1,2,1,13,1,5, 14 (1/26, 5 places outside this) 

My Verdict: The going if officially good at York, and possibly on the easy side of good. I cannot see it drying out enough but you never know. He was 3rd in this race last season off a slightly higher mark (and on softer ground) which catches the eye and he was always out the back on his seasonal reappearance - whether that means his is just regressive or has a target in mind I am not sure. Given he is 20/1 in places he is perhaps worth keeping an eye on. His best and most consistent form has been on a very quick surface. 

He will not go down as a qualifier unless the official going changes to Good to Firm. If it was good to firm I would have advised 1/2 point EW at those odds, 4 places.
